• 2022-06-01
    关于递归函数的说法中,不正确的是( )
    A: 递归函数可以改写为非递归函数
    B: 递归函数应有递归结束的条件
    C: 解决同一个问题的递归函数的效率比非递归函数的效率要高
    D: 递归函数往往更符合人们的思路,程序更容易理解
  • C

    举一反三

    内容

    • 0

      下面关于递归说法正确的是: A: 递归出口和递归关系是递归函数编写的关键 B: 在能够使用递归函数的时候,尽量使用递归,因为它可以使得程序变得简洁,易于理解 C: 递归函数的嵌套调用次数没有限制 D: 递归函数的执行效率优于非递归函数

    • 1

      ‏下面关于递归说法正确的是:​ A: 一般条件和基础条件是递归函数编写的关键 B: 在能够使用递归函数的时候,尽量使用递归,因为它可以使得程序变得简洁,易于理解 C: 递归函数的嵌套调用次数没有限制 D: 递归函数的执行效率优于非递归函数

    • 2

      下面关于递归说法正确的是: A: 一般条件和基础条件是递归函数编写的关键 B: 在能够使用递归函数的时候,尽量使用递归,因为它可以使得程序变得简洁,易于理解 C: 递归函数的嵌套调用次数没有限制 D: 递归函数的执行效率优于非递归函数

    • 3

      以下哪项陈述是正确的? A: 递归函数比非递归函数运行得更快。 B: 非递归函数通常比递归函数占用更多的内存空间 C: 递归函数总是可以被非递归函数代替。 D: 在某些情况下,使用递归可以为一个程序提供一个自然、直接、简单的解决方案,否则这个程序将很难解决。

    • 4

      关于递归函数的说法错误的是: A: 递归函数必须在函数体内有调用本函数的代码 B: 递归函数必须有终止递归调用的条件 C: 递归函数必须有返回值 D: 一般来说,可以使用循环来解决与递归函数相同的问题